IP66 Technical Support for Communication Power Supply Cabinets

IP66 Technical Support for Communication Power Supply Cabinets

These advanced enclosures deliver reliable protection for critical electrical and communication equipment in outdoor heavy-duty settings. Protection: IP66 IK10 (Non-ventilated); IP55 IK10 (Ventilated) Standards (& Conformities): IEC/EN 60529, IEC/EN 62208, EIA-310-D, RoHS, CE.

Technical requirements for solar power irrigation

Technical requirements for solar power irrigation

According to Sass and Hahn (2020), the data required to design a solar-powered irrigation system are: crop data (crop type, growing season, crop rotation, and water demand); water data (availability of water); site data (longitude, latitude, water source, and pumping head); and.
